Texans Extend Win Streak to 3 Games and Gear Up to Take on Jaguars

The Houston Texans secured a win against Arizona on Sunday, marking their third consecutive victory. Their upcoming matchup with Jacksonville could propel them to the top spot in the AFC South. Despite the Jaguars holding a 7-3 record, the Texans’ previous victory over them means that a win in the next game would place them in the division’s lead. Quarterback C.J. Stroud’s promising performance has been pivotal in the Texans’ recent success. With 2,962 passing yards, Stroud stands out as a rookie, garnering his fans’ chants of “M-V-P”. The team’s ability to run the ball effectively has been a key asset, with Devin Singletary delivering standout performances in the running game. However, the Texans have struggled with sustaining their momentum in the second half of games, highlighting the need for consistent execution. Defensive players such as CB Derek Stingley have shown promise, but the absence of linebacker Denzel Perryman due to suspension and other injuries presents challenges. Moving forward, Stroud’s ability to minimize turnovers will be crucial for the Texans as they aim to continue their winning streak against the Jaguars.
